The Rise of UConn’s Women’s Basketball Program
UConn’s women’s basketball team began its journey to national prominence in the 1990s under coach Geno Auriemma. The program quickly gained recognition for its disciplined play, innovative strategies, and a roster filled with talented athletes. This rise culminated in multiple NCAA championships, establishing UConn as a powerhouse.

Impact on College Sports
UConn’s success has had a profound influence on college sports. It has increased the visibility and popularity of women’s basketball, inspired other programs to elevate their standards, and contributed to the growth of college athletics as a whole. Their dominance challenged traditional notions of competitive balance and raised questions about the role of recruiting and resources in building a dynasty.
Broader Cultural Significance
Beyond the court, UConn’s dynasty has fostered discussions about gender equality in sports, the importance of Title IX, and the potential for college athletics to serve as platforms for social change. The program’s success has also helped to elevate the profile of women athletes nationally and internationally.
